Experimental Spectroscopic Data of SnO2 Films and Powder

Powders and films composed of tin dioxide (SnO2) are promising candidates for a variety high-impact applications, despite the material’s prevalence in such studies, it remains high importance that commercially available materials meet quality demands industries these would most benefit. Imaging techniques, as scanning electron microscopy (SEM), atomic force (AFM), were used conjunction with Raman spectroscopy X-ray photoelectron (XPS) to assess samples, powder thin film on quartz thicknesses 41 nm, 78 97 373 908 nm. In this study, dependencies corresponding Raman, XPS, SEM analysis results properties like thickness form (powder versus film) determined. The outcomes achieved can be regarded guide performing checks products, reference evaluate samples.
